Abstract: Photocopies of speeches, writings, and correspondence of the American economist Milton Friedman, and recordings of his television
appearances. Project sponsored in part by the Hoover Institution on War, Revolution and Peace. Used as research material for
The Collected Works of Milton Friedman, compiled and edited by Robert Leeson and Charles G. Palm. Much of the material is available online as part of the Collected
Works of Milton Friedman website,
http://miltonfriedman.hoover.org .

Scope and Content of Collection
The Collected Works of Milton Friedman Project records include photocopies of speeches, writings, and correspondence of the
American economist Milton Friedman, and recordings of his television appearances. The records were used as research material
for
The Collected Works of Milton Friedman, compiled and edited by Robert Leeson and Charles G. Palm.
The purpose of this project was the publication of all Friedman's writings. It was originally sponsored by Palgrave Macmillan
Limited, who planned to publish the materials as a multivolume set. After Palgrave withdrew, the project was sponsored by
the Hoover Institution on War, Revolution and Peace. Much of the material has now been published online as part of the Collected
Works of Milton Friedman website,
http://miltonfriedman.hoover.org .
In addition to photocopies of Friedman's writings and correspondence, the collection includes files related to the project,
such as database guides, correspondence concerning copyright permissions, and various electronic files. The records also include
materials that were ultimately excluded from
The Collected Works of Milton Friedman.
